    Rotafix provide technical advice to Architects and Specifiers looking for in situ repair solutions for historic buildings requiring repairs to their timber frames wthout disturbing the removal of the roof or floors of the building. If you need to maintain the period features of the building that is listed or protected, Rotafix will provide a solution to meet your needs that will maintain the character of the building. Restoring and repairing the timber elements in situ is a cost effective method of undertaking repairs with minimal disruption. Rotafix will supply the design and structural adhesives, grouts and connectors required to make your repairs.and give you the calculations to give you confidence that the repairs will last the test of time. Rotafix Adhesives and Grouts have been tested to ISO15274 so you can rest assured the product will consistently give you the levels of performance that you need to make a certifiable repair. Rotafix adhesives have been developed specifically for the restoration and repair of timver, their mechnical properties are very similar to that of wood and can be used externally and internally in all types of wood, accoya, glue laminated timber and wood engineered products such as versalam and paralam. Rotafix were established in 1974 and are currently distributing products to Europe, Asia and North America.
